What is a part time Sentara RN?

A Part Time Sentara RN is a registered nurse who works for Sentara Healthcare on a part-time basis, typically working fewer hours per week than a full-time nurse. These nurses provide patient care, administer medications, and collaborate with healthcare teams, but usually have more flexible schedules. Part-time RNs may work in various settings, such as hospitals, clinics, or outpatient centers within the Sentara network. The role allows nurses to maintain a work-life balance while still contributing to patient care and the organization’s mission.

What is the difference between Part Time Sentara Rn vs Part Time Sentara Lpn?

AspectPart Time Sentara RnPart Time Sentara Lpn
Required CredentialsRegistered Nurse (RN) licenseLicensed Practical Nurse (LPN) license
Work EnvironmentHospitals, clinics, acute care settingsLong-term care, outpatient clinics, skilled nursing facilities
Job ResponsibilitiesPatient assessments, care planning, medication administrationBasic patient care, vital signs, assisting RNs

Part Time Sentara Rn roles typically require an RN license and involve more complex patient care tasks in hospital settings. In contrast, Part Time Sentara Lpn positions require an LPN license and focus on basic patient care in outpatient or long-term care environments. Both roles are essential but differ in scope, responsibilities, and required credentials.
